Dormont Manufacturing Co is looking for a Physical Health Lead Nurse (RGN) to join the team at Cygnet Hospital Ealing. The role involves leading physical health initiatives and requires strong experience in GP surgery or general hospital outpatient clinics.

The position offers a flexible schedule of 24 hours a week. Additional benefits include an NHS discount scheme, free meals, and a career development pathway. Commitment to patient recovery is essential. Apply now to make a difference.

Some tips for your application 🫡

Highlight Your Clinical Skills:When you’re crafting your CV for a nursing role, make sure to focus on your clinical skills and hands-on experience. Detail any specific areas of patient care you excel in, such as wound management or patient education.

Showcase Your Communication Skills:In nursing, strong communication is key, both with patients and fellow staff. Use your cover letter to tell us about a time you effectively communicated with a patient or a team member, showing your ability to work well in a part-time capacity.

Tailor Your Availability:As you’re applying for a part-time position, specify your availability clearly in your application. Highlight how your schedule can support the team's needs at Dormont Manufacturing Co, making you an ideal choice for flexible shifts.

Include Relevant Certifications:Don’t forget to mention any nursing certifications or training you’ve completed that are relevant to the role.
